#7f431e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7f431e is composed of 49.8% red, 26.3%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.2% magenta, 76.4%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 22.9 degrees, a saturation of 61.8% and a lightness of 30.8%. #7f431e color hex could be obtained by blending #fe863c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#7f431e color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
#7f431e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7f431e has RGB values of R:127, G:67,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.47, Y:0.76,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 8340254.
